March 15: Largest Anti-War Protest Yet in New Orleans
Over 1000 people rallied against a preemptive US attack, in a demonstration the Times-Picayune wrote "may be N.O.'s largest in decades." Marching from Armstrong Park to Jackson Square, protestors blocked traffic on Rampart, Canal, St. Peters and Decatur. Protestors were allied with others in cities across the world and the nation, including over 45,000 thousand in Washington DC and 80,000 in San Francisco. There was a candlelight vigil from 7pm-8pm the next night, March 16, in Jackson Square.

Feb 15 - New Orleans: Louisiana Joins World in Denouncing War Plans
Approximately 700-1200 people came together in New Orleans on Feb 15 to join with millions of other protestors in over 600 cities across the world, all denouncing Bush's plan for a preemptive war on the people of Iraq. The march in New Orleans featured a diverse group of people, including local flavor such as a sign reading, "Make Mardi Gras Not War" and people sipping beer from to-go cups, all adding to an upbeat take back the streets experience. Protests were also held in Shreveport [ more info | photos ] and the day before in Lafayette.

Nov 23 - New Orleans
On Saturday Nov 23 hundreds of people from across Louisiana gathered in New Orleans to protest a possible US war on Iraq's citizens. Several hundred people from Baton Rouge, Lafayette, Shreveport, and New Orleans, gathered at Congo Square in New Orleans at noon before marching along Rampart and Canal streets to Jackson Square for a peace rally. Protestors filled the road, blocking traffic for blocks and eliciting a mostly positive response from passerbys.
